在这个数字化时代,移动应用已经成为了人们生活中不可或缺的一部分。微信小程序作为近年来兴起的一种新型应用形式,以其便捷、轻量、快速的特点,深受用户喜爱。掌握微信小程序框架,你也能轻松打造出个性化的移动应用。下面,我们就来详细了解一下微信小程序框架及其应用。
一、微信小程序简介
微信小程序是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的概念。用户扫一扫或搜一下即可打开应用。微信小程序具有以下特点:
- 无需下载安装:用户无需下载和安装即可使用。
- 快速启动:启动速度快,用户体验好。
- 无需更新:无需手动更新,后台自动更新。
- 功能丰富:支持多种功能,如微信支付、地图、摄像头等。
- 跨平台:支持Android、iOS、Windows等平台。
二、微信小程序框架
微信小程序框架主要包括以下几个部分:
- WXML:类似于HTML,用于描述页面结构。
- WXSS:类似于CSS,用于描述页面样式。
- JS:类似于JavaScript,用于描述页面逻辑。
- JSON:用于描述页面配置。
1. WXML
WXML是微信小程序的页面结构描述语言,类似于HTML。它用于描述页面的布局和内容。以下是一个简单的WXML示例:
<view class="container">
<text>欢迎来到我的小程序</text>
</view>
2. WXSS
WXSS是微信小程序的样式描述语言,类似于CSS。它用于描述页面的样式,如颜色、字体、布局等。以下是一个简单的WXSS示例:
.container {
display: flex;
justify-content: center;
align-items: center;
height: 100%;
}
.text {
font-size: 24px;
color: #333;
}
3. JS
JS是微信小程序的逻辑描述语言,类似于JavaScript。它用于描述页面的交互逻辑,如事件处理、数据绑定等。以下是一个简单的JS示例:
Page({
data: {
text: 'Hello, World!'
},
onLoad: function() {
this.setData({
text: '欢迎来到我的小程序'
});
}
});
4. JSON
JSON用于描述页面的配置,如页面标题、页面路径等。以下是一个简单的JSON示例:
{
"navigationBarTitleText": "我的小程序"
}
三、个性化移动应用打造
掌握微信小程序框架后,你可以根据需求打造个性化的移动应用。以下是一些建议:
- 明确目标用户:了解你的目标用户,设计符合他们需求的应用。
- 创新功能:结合自身特点,开发独特的功能,吸引用户。
- 优化用户体验:关注用户界面和交互设计,提升用户体验。
- 持续更新:根据用户反馈,不断优化和更新应用。
四、总结
掌握微信小程序框架,你就能轻松打造出个性化的移动应用。通过学习WXML、WXSS、JS和JSON等基础知识,结合实际需求,你将能够开发出满足用户需求的高质量小程序。祝你成功!
